Robert Downey Jr. Presents A Real Bionic Iron Man Arm To A Special Child
March 12, 2015
Alex is a 7 year-old boy who loves superheroes and riding his bike. He was also born with a partially developed right arm.

Albert Manero is a college student who builds and donates low cost, 3D-printed bionic limbs to kids around the world. For the last two weeks, Albert has been asking for support as part of the #CollectiveProject.
A leading bionics expert heard the story and wanted to help.

Robert Downey Jr. pretending to be Tony Stark and Albert surprised Alex with a new bionic 3D-printed arm at no cost to the family that resembled the bionic arm of Iron Man himself.
